India: 11 dead in central railway collision
Bilaspur, India – November 5, 2025: At least eleven people were killed and several others injured on Tuesday evening in a collision between a passenger train and a freight train in central India.
The accident occurred near the city of Bilaspur, about 115 kilometers northeast of Raipur, the capital of Chhattisgarh state, when the passenger train struck the rear of the freight train, according to senior government official Sanjay Agarwal.
Rescue teams worked for hours to clear the damaged carriage using cranes and plasma cutters. The passenger train’s driver was among the deceased, while his co-driver sustained serious injuries and was hospitalized in a private clinic. Around twenty additional passengers were also injured and taken to local hospitals.
Indian Railways mobilized resources for the rescue operation and has launched an investigation to determine the cause of the accident. The operator also announced financial assistance for the families of victims and the injured.
Despite ongoing government efforts to improve railway safety, India continues to experience hundreds of accidents each year, some fatal, in a country where over 12 million passengers travel daily on approximately 14,000 trains.
